Diophantine Conditions and Global Properties for Systems of Vector Fields in Tori and Spheres

  • Alexandre Kirilov,
  • Ricardo Paleari da Silva

摘要

In this note, we explore global properties for systems of first-order differential operators, with a focus on zero-order perturbations of constant-coefficient vector fields defined on products of tori and three-dimensional spheres. By analyzing the behavior of the symbol of the system, we establish necessary and sufficient conditions for achieving global hypoellipticity, global analytic hypoellipticity and global solvability.
